Holly shrub pruning services involve the careful trimming and shaping of holly plants to promote healthy growth and maintain an attractive appearance. These services typically include removing dead or damaged branches, thinning out dense areas, and shaping the shrub to fit the desired aesthetic. Proper pruning can help improve air circulation within the shrub, reduce the risk of disease, and encourage new growth, ensuring the holly remains vibrant and healthy throughout the year.

Pruning holly shrubs can address several common problems, such as overgrowth that encroaches on walkways or structures, and the presence of dead or diseased branches that can compromise the plant’s health. Regular maintenance also helps prevent the shrub from becoming unruly or leggy, which can detract from the property's curb appeal. Additionally, pruning can encourage larger, more colorful berries in the fall, enhancing the visual interest of the landscape.

The overview below groups typical Holly Shrub Pruning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Will County,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Shrub Pruning - The cost typically ranges from $50 to $150 for standard shrub pruning services. This includes trimming small to medium-sized shrubs to maintain shape and health.

Medium-Size Shrub Pruning - Expect prices between $100 and $300 depending on the shrub size and complexity of the trimming. Larger or more overgrown shrubs may increase the cost.

Heavy or Overgrown Shrub Removal - Costs for removing or heavily pruning overgrown shrubs can range from $200 to $500 or more. This service often involves significant trimming or complete removal.

Seasonal Shrub Maintenance - Regular pruning services throughout the year generally cost between $75 and $200 per session. Prices vary based on shrub quantity and size in the landscape.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of pruning holly shrubs? Pruning holly shrubs can help maintain their shape, promote healthy growth, and improve their overall appearance.

When is the best time to prune holly shrubs? The ideal time to prune holly shrubs is typically in late winter or early spring before new growth begins.

How do professionals prune holly shrubs? Local service providers use techniques such as selective trimming and shaping to ensure the shrub's health and aesthetic appeal.

Are there different pruning methods for holly shrubs? Yes, methods like thinning, heading, and reshaping are used depending on the shrub's condition and desired outcome.

Can pruning harm holly shrubs if done improperly? Yes, improper pruning can lead to stress or damage, so it's recommended to work with experienced local pros for best results.
